In 2022, Horgos port achieves increasing import and export cargo volume for 10 consecutive months year-on-year

Photo taken on November 12, 2022 shows Horgos Customs officers inspect and release export vehicles and goods. (Photo by correspondent: Dilnur Bahtjan)

Shiliuyun-Xinjiang Daily (Reporter Chen Qiangwei) news: Reporter learned from the Horgos Customs that in October, 2022, the import and export cargo volume of Horgos port, Xinjiang, China was 3.265 million tons, up 5.4% year on year. The trade volume of import and export was 27.2 billion yuan, up by 10% year on year. In 2022, Horgos port achieves increasing import and export cargo and trade volume for 10 consecutive months year-on-year.

In the first 10 months of 2022, the import and export cargo volume of Horgos port was 33.727 million tons and the trade volume was 244.42 billion yuan, up 3.6% and 5.6% respectively year on year. Among them, the export cargo volume was 4.447 million tons, up 17.5% year on year. The volume of import cargo was 29.28 million tons, up 1.8% year on year. The export and import trade volume were 157.12 billion yuan and 87.3 billion yuan respectively, up 25.2 % year on year.

In terms of commodity types, the main import commodities at Horgos port in the first 10 months of 2022 were mechanical and electrical products, unwrought copper and copper materials, etc., and export commodities were high-tech products, garment and accessories, etc. In terms of the way of transport, railway transport is still the main way of import and export. Benefited from the measures taken by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region this year, import and export trade volume of road transport has increased 57.7% year on year.

"In the current round of the epidemic in Xinjiang, the Horgos port has maintained unimpeded freight flow, and our production and business activities have not been affected. Now we can export 30 to 40 wagons of goods every day, with the peak of more than 50 wagons. The daily export cargo volume is about 900 tons, mainly to Central Asian countries." said Yu Chengzhong, whose company is one of the larger import and export trading companies in Horgos. He also said the company has expanded its import and export business, benefiting from the smooth flow through the port.

In order to further enhance the opening-up of the port, improve the efficiency of port clearance, and ensure the stable and smooth clearance of import and export, the Horgos Customs has further promoted the reform of ‘clearance, management and service’, constantly optimized the overall cargo clearance process, and worked closely with port joint inspection units to reduce the time limit of cargo clearance.

Ma Lei, deputy chief of the general business department of Horgos Customs, said that in order to further optimize the port business environment, the customs continues to adopt the 7×24 (24 hour a day, 7 days a week) customs clearance operation mode, make good use of intelligent platforms such as ‘one-stand window’ and ‘Internet + Customs’ for international trade, realize integrated customs clearance, and push forward various business facilitation reforms such as self-service declaration and payment, aggregate taxation and electronic payment. Customs clearance has been further facilitated to contribute to the unimpeded domestic and international circulations, the security and stability of industrial and supply chains.
